WebPlutonium-238, plutonium-239, and plutonium-240 are the most common isotopes. Plutonium uses are focused on its ability to generate enormous amounts of energy. Applications of plutonium include its use in nuclear power reactors, nuclear weapons, and medicine. Since plutonium emits alpha radiation, it poses an internal exposure health … WebThe half-life is the time it takes for half of the plutonium to undergo radioactive decay and change forms. The half-life of plutonium-238 is 87.7 years. The half-life of plutonium-239 is 24,100 years. Plutonium-239 is used to manufacture nuclear weapons.
